protected void CASGrid_SelectionChanged(object sender, EventArgs e) { if (CASGridView.Selection.Count > 0) { if (Session["UserFullName"] != null) { List <object> fieldValues = CASGridView.GetSelectedFieldValues(new string[] { "redirectto" }); // System.Windows.Forms.MessageBox.Show(fieldValues.Count.ToString()); //System.Windows.Forms.MessageBox.Show(); //DevExpress.Web.ASPxWebControl.RedirectOnCallback(fieldValues[0].ToString()); Response.Redirect(fieldValues[0].ToString() + "&TabType=CAS"); } } }
public void FillCASGrid() { string CASList = ""; DataTable dt = new DataTable(); dt = VSWebBL.ExchangeBAL.Ins.GetCASStatus(); Session["CASStatusGrid"] = dt; //CASList.Text = "0"; CASList = "0"; if (dt != null && dt.Rows.Count > 0) { //CASList.Text = dt.Rows.Count.ToString(); CASList = dt.Rows.Count.ToString(); } CASGridView.DataSource = dt; CASGridView.DataBind(); //7/18/2014 NS added DataRow rolerow = srvroles.Rows.Add(); rolerow["Role"] = "CAS"; rolerow["RoleCount"] = Convert.ToInt32(CASList); }
public void FillCASGridfromSession() { DataTable DataServers = new DataTable(); try { if (Session["CASStatusGrid"] != null && Session["CASStatusGrid"] != "") { DataServers = Session["CASStatusGrid"] as DataTable; } if (DataServers.Rows.Count > 0) { DataServers.PrimaryKey = new DataColumn[] { DataServers.Columns["ID"] }; //CASList.Text = DataServers.Rows.Count.ToString(); } CASGridView.DataSource = DataServers; CASGridView.DataBind(); } catch (Exception ex) { Log.Entry.Ins.WriteHistoryEntry(DateTime.Now.ToString() + " Exception - " + ex); throw ex; } }